2, 1956, Daily Variety ran a front-page headline WB Consults Psychologists On Handling Giant Problem Of James Dean Cultism. The story said even after his death, Dean was receiving 5,000 to 6,000 fan letters a week, and the studio was trying to deal with the fans as it prepared the release of Giant. The problem was how to channel the adoration of Dean into affirmative directions rather than let the macabre aspects get out of control
